Cherry-Almond Glazed Pork Loin





Serves Serves 6-8 |
Ingredients:
| 3 lbs. pork loin |
| 1 (2 oz.) jar cherry preserves |
| 2 tbsp light corn syrup |
| 1/4 c red wine vinegar |
| 1/4 tsp salt |
| 1/4 tsp ground cinnamon |
| 1/4 tsp ground nutmeg |
| 1/4 tsp ground cloves |
| 3 tbsp slivered almonds, toasted |
Directions:
- Roast pork loin on rack in shallow baking pan, uncovered in slow 325 degree oven for about 2 to 2 1/2 hours.
- Mix all ingredients except almonds and heat to boiling, stirring frequently; reduce heat and simmer 2 minutes. Add toasted almonds. Keep sauce warm. After roasting pork loin 2 1/2 hours. Spoon hot sauce over roast to glaze. Return to oven for about 30 minutes or until meat thermometer registers 170 degrees. Baste roast with sauce several times during last 30 minutes. Pass remaining sauce with roast if all was not used to glaze roast.
